What they do

An Occupational Therapy Assistant assists occupational therapists to help patients with injuries, illnesses, or disabilities. Helps patients to recover and develop skills need for daily activities. Helps patients learn exercises and teaches them to use therapeutic equipment. Works in the office of an occupational therapist or in a healthcare facility.

3 Pasadena, CA Job Details Per diem 11 hours ago Qualifications CPR Certification Occupational Therapy Assistant License BLS Certification COTA Full Job Description GEM Transition Care Center is a 75 bed skilled nursing facility specializing in short-term therapy and dedicated to providing all of our residents with the type of care they deserve. We offer a variety of therapies and care services to assist patients in regaining their independence, whether they are recovering from a hospital stay or require ongoing medical support. As a valued team member, you will collaborate with therapists, patients, their families and the IDT to guide each patient through a personalized therapy program, helping them reach their recovery goals. REQUIREMENTS
CPR Certification is mandatory. Licensed Certified Occupational Therapist Assistant is required. Preferably 1-2 years of experience in long-term care. Good physical and mental health is essential. Capable of meeting physical demands of the role, including lifting up to 50 pounds unassisted. Ability to follow both oral and written instructions. Possess training, knowledge, and experience for general duties under supervision.
REPORTING
The Certified Occupational Therapist Assistant reports to the supervising Occupational Therapist and/or Rehabilitation Director.
JOB DUTIES
Understanding of physical medicine, therapy modalities, anatomy, and physiology. Familiarity with operating physical therapy equipment, maintenance, and repairs. Administering treatment and rehabilitation services to patients with injuries or disabilities. Following treatment plans directed by the Occupational Therapist. Monitoring and documenting patient treatment and progress. Assisting in developing educational plans based on learning needs. Ensuring documentation meets current standards and policies.
